Summary

Ged is a boy from the island of Gont, born with innate magical talent and a reckless nature, who tampers with long-held secrets and releases a terrible shadow into the world. Notes

General note

Earthsea ; 1-3

BBC radio dramatisation of Ursula Le Guin's first three books of Earthsea series; A wizard of Earthsea, The tombs of Atuan and The farthest shore as well as the stand alone, award-winning novel, The left hand of darkness.

Also contains the interview conducted by Naomi Alderman with Ursula Le Guin about her life and work on BBC Radio4.
